#a23633 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a23633 is composed of 63.5% red, 21.2%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.7% magenta, 68.5%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 1.6 degrees, a saturation of 52.1% and a lightness of 41.8%. #a23633 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6c66 with #450000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

Shades and Tints of #a23633

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0404 is the darkest color, while #fefd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#a23633

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#716464 is the less saturated color, while #d30802 is the most saturated one.
